comparemela.com

Top Locations Tagged with Cyber Security Solutions Jobs

Cyber Security Solutions Jobs in India - 133001/Home-security-company near Ambala

1). Cyber Security Solutions Ambala

Cyber Security Solutions Jobs in United States - 22554/Lighting-fixtures near Stafford

2). Cyber Security Solutions, Stafford

Cyber Security Solutions Jobs in United States - 22304/Security-systems near City Of Alexandria

3). Cyber Security Solutons Inc, Holmes Run Pkwy Apt

vimarsana © 2020. All Rights Reserved.